WebbTough and compact, Campanula carpatica (Carpathian Bellflower) is a low-growing perennial with masses of large, upward-facing, bell-shaped flowers in shades of blue, purple or white over a long season. WebbThis adorable little flower with bell-shaped blooms is sure to be a favorite in any garden. While it can grow in both white and purple/blue varieties, blue is the most common. Bellflowers make a perfect ground cover plant and also grow well in window boxes. Plant in full sun or partial shade. Needs well-drained soil.
